What Makes Single Origin Coffee Different
Single origin coffee captures the authentic character of a specific region rather than blending flavors from multiple sources. You're getting beans from one farm, one country, or one defined geographic area, not a mix sourced from different places.
The difference is immediate on the palate. An Ethiopian single origin tastes distinctly different from Colombian or Guatemalan coffee because each region's unique elevation, soil composition, climate, and farming practices create a flavor profile belonging to that place alone. Blended coffees combine beans from different origins to create consistent taste year-round. That consistency comes at a cost: distinctive regional character gets smoothed out. Single origin coffees embrace variation, harvest season changes flavor slightly, processing methods create complexity. These are features that make single origin coffee worth seeking out.
Single Origin vs Blend Coffee: Understanding the Core Difference
Single origin and blend coffees serve different purposes. Single origin tastes better for drinkers who want to experience the specific terroir and processing character of a particular region. You're tasting the story of that place: altitude, soil, weather that season, and the farmer's processing choices. Every cup carries those variables.
Blended coffees combine beans from multiple origins to create consistent flavor profiles. The roaster balances acidity, body, and sweetness across different sources to hit a target taste. Consistency is the advantage; if you find a blend you love, it tastes the same every time. Individual regional characteristics get diluted.
For home brewing, single origin coffees demand more attention. Water temperature, grind size, and brew time matter more because the beans have more complexity to extract. Blends are often formulated to be forgiving.
| Characteristic | Single Origin | Blend |
|---|---|---|
| Flavor Profile | Unique to region; varies seasonally | Consistent year-round |
| Complexity | High; expresses terroir and processing | Balanced; flavors complement each other |
| Traceability | Full; you know the farm or region | Limited; multiple sources blended |
| Brewing Sensitivity | High; extraction variables matter more | Lower; more forgiving with technique |
| Supply | Limited; depends on harvest and processing | Stable; roaster adjusts sources as needed |
| Price Point | Often higher per pound | Competitive pricing |
The choice isn't about one being objectively better. If consistency and ease matter most, a blend works. If you want to explore how geography and processing shape flavor, single origin is the path.
How Terroir Shapes Flavor in Single Origin Beans
Terroir is the complete environmental context where coffee grows: elevation, climate, humidity, rainfall patterns, and the specific microclimate of each farm. These factors combine to create the flavor profile you taste in your cup.
Coffee grown at high elevation develops more complex sugars and acids because cooler temperatures slow plant growth, extending the growing season and concentrating flavor compounds. A coffee from Ethiopian or Guatemalan mountains will taste noticeably brighter and more nuanced than the same varietal grown at lower elevation.

Regional characteristics also depend on soil composition. Volcanic soil, common in Central America, imparts mineral and earthy notes. Different soil types influence how plants absorb nutrients, directly affecting the bean's chemistry and final taste.
Elevation and Regional Characteristics
Elevation is one of the most direct influences on single origin coffee flavor. Beans grown between 1,200 and 2,200 meters above sea level typically develop the most complex flavor profiles. The cooler air forces the plant to work harder, producing denser beans with more developed flavor compounds.
Different regions have signature elevation profiles. Ethiopian coffees often grow at 1,500-2,100 meters, producing fruity and floral notes. Guatemalan coffees from the Antigua region sit at 1,500-1,700 meters and develop chocolate, caramel, and bright fruit characteristics. Regional characteristics extend beyond flavor to include the cultivar planted. A Bourbon varietal in Colombia tastes different from the same varietal in Ethiopia because terroir changes how the plant expresses its genetic potential.
Soil, Climate, and Harvest Season
Soil composition directly influences mineral content in the beans. Coffee plants absorb nutrients from the soil, and those nutrients become part of the bean's chemistry. Volcanic soil creates different mineral profiles than clay or limestone soil, which is why a coffee from a volcanic region often has a slightly different mineral or earthy character.
Climate patterns determine when harvest happens and what weather conditions existed during growing season. A wet season followed by a dry season at the right time produces beans with optimal ripeness. This is why single origin coffee tastes better in some years than others from the same farm. Rainfall also shapes flavor, moderate, consistent rainfall during growing season produces balanced beans, while too much rain dilutes sugars and too little produces smaller, denser beans with concentrated but sometimes harsh flavors.
Processing Methods That Unlock Flavor Complexity
How coffee cherries are processed after picking dramatically changes the final flavor. Three main processing methods dominate specialty coffee: washed, natural, and honey process.
Washed process removes the fruit from the bean immediately after picking, then ferments the beans to break down remaining mucilage. This method emphasizes the bean's origin characteristics and produces cleaner, brighter acidity. The processing method is neutral, letting the bean speak for itself.
Natural process leaves the fruit on the bean while it dries. The bean absorbs sugars and flavors from the drying fruit, creating a sweeter, fruitier cup with pronounced fruit notes like blueberry, strawberry, or tropical fruit.
Honey process splits the difference. The fruit gets removed, but some mucilage stays on the bean during drying. The amount of mucilage left determines how much fruit character ends up in the cup. Each processing method is valid, and the choice depends on what the farmer wants to emphasize. Single origin coffee tastes better when the processing method matches the regional characteristics.
How to Brew Single Origin Coffee for Maximum Flavor
Brewing single origin coffee requires attention to extraction variables because the beans have more flavor complexity to extract. Water temperature, grind size, brew time, and water quality all influence whether you pull out the best flavors.
The ideal brewing temperature is 195-205 degrees Fahrenheit. Too hot over-extracts, pulling bitter compounds. Too cool under-extracts, missing sweetness and complexity. Single origin coffees are sensitive to this range.
Grind size controls how quickly water contacts the coffee. Finer grinds expose more surface area, speeding extraction. Coarser grinds slow it down. Match your grind to your brewing method: pour-over needs medium-fine grind, French press needs coarse, espresso needs very fine.

Brew time varies by method. Pour-over typically takes 3-4 minutes, French press takes 4 minutes, espresso takes 25-30 seconds. Adjust based on taste: if your cup tastes sour or thin, you're under-extracting; increase brew time or use finer grind. If it tastes bitter, you're over-extracting; decrease brew time or use coarser grind.
Water quality matters more than most realize. Tap water with high chlorine or mineral content affects flavor. Filtered water or bottled water produces cleaner results.
Extraction Variables and Sensory Experience
Extraction is the process of dissolving the coffee's soluble compounds into hot water. Optimal extraction pulls out the sugars, acids, and flavor compounds that create complexity and sweetness. Under-extraction produces sour, thin cups. Over-extraction pulls out bitter compounds, creating harsh, astringent flavors.
Single origin coffee tastes better when extraction is dialed in because you taste the full range of what the beans offer. A properly extracted cup shows the acidity, body, and flavor notes the terroir and processing created. You might taste floral notes of an Ethiopian natural process coffee or the chocolate and butterscotch of a Guatemalan medium roast.
Brightness refers to the acidity in the cup, a sharpness or liveliness on the palate. High-elevation, washed-process coffees tend to have more brightness. Mouthfeel describes the weight and texture: light, medium, or full body. Processing method and roast profile influence this. Sweetness comes from properly extracted sugars.
Traceability and Transparency: Why It Matters
Knowing where your single origin coffee comes from matters because it tells you whether the beans actually express their terroir and whether farmers were paid fairly. Traceability means you can trace the beans back to the specific farm or region where they grew.
Transparent roasters publish information about their sourcing: farm name or cooperative, region, elevation, processing method, and often the farmer's name. This transparency lets you verify that the coffee is actually single origin and not a blend disguised as such. It also tells you the roaster has a direct relationship with the farmer, a sign of quality and fair pricing.
Direct trade relationships between roasters and farmers ensure farmers receive prices above commodity rates. When a roaster works directly with a farmer rather than buying through middlemen, more money reaches the person who grew the beans. This incentivizes farmers to invest in quality rather than volume.

Traceability also protects you from greenwashing. Some roasters claim single origin sourcing without verifying it or use vague regional descriptions that hide blending. Transparent roasters provide specifics: farm name, elevation, harvest date, processing method. If your roaster can't or won't provide these details, that's a red flag.
The Trade-Off: Consistency vs. Uniqueness
Single origin coffee tastes better if you value uniqueness and regional character. The trade-off is that consistency suffers. Each harvest brings slight variations in flavor because weather, soil conditions, and processing techniques vary year to year.
This inconsistency frustrates some drinkers. If you buy the same single origin coffee twice and it tastes slightly different, that's not a quality failure, that's terroir expressing itself across seasons. A wetter year produces different flavor than a drier year.
Blended coffees solve this problem by combining beans from multiple origins and adjusting blend proportions to hit a consistent target flavor. For specialty coffee drinkers, seasonal variation is part of the appeal. For everyday drinkers who want reliable flavor, blends make more sense.
Cost is another trade-off. Single origin coffees typically cost more per pound than blends because supply is limited and sourcing requires direct relationships with farmers. Frequently Asked Questions
Does single origin coffee always taste better than a blend?
Single origin coffee offers distinct, traceable flavor profiles that reflect its specific terroir, elevation, and processing method. However, 'better' depends on your preference. Single origin beans highlight regional characteristics and complexity, while blends are engineered for consistency and balance. If you value exploring unique flavor notes and sensory experiences, single origin will feel superior. If you prefer reliable, balanced flavor every morning, a blend may suit you better.
What is the difference between single origin and blend coffee?
Single origin coffee comes from one specific farm, region, or country, delivering unique flavor profiles shaped by local terroir and processing methods. Blends combine beans from multiple origins to achieve consistent taste and balanced body. Single origin emphasizes complexity and regional characteristics, think fruity notes from Ethiopia or chocolate from Guatemala. Blends prioritize predictability and smoothness, making them ideal for daily brewing without variation.
How does geography affect the flavor profile of coffee beans?
Geography determines everything about coffee flavor. Elevation affects acidity and brightness; higher altitudes produce more complex, acidic beans. Soil composition influences sweetness and body. Climate patterns during the harvest season shape ripeness and sugar development. These environmental factors, collectively called terroir, create the foundation for flavor. A Colombian bean from Medellin develops different characteristics than an Ethiopian varietal from Sidama, even when processed identically.
